Tips for storing your dorm room
Storing your dorm room effectively is crucial, especially if you plan to move out at the end of the semester or academic year. Here are some tips from our storage experts to help you successfully store your dorm room:
- Start Early: Don't wait until the last minute to begin packing and organizing.
- Declutter: Go through your belongings and decide what you really need and what you can live without.
- Plan and Organize: Create a plan for how you want to store your items. This might involve categorizing, labeling, and making a checklist.
- Use Storage Bins and Boxes: Use storage bins or purchase our boxes to protect your items from dust and damage.
- Label Everything: Label each box with its contents. This will make it easier to find what you need later.
- Pack Fragile Items Carefully: Use bubble wrap, packing paper, or old clothes to wrap fragile items like glassware or electronics.
- Furniture Disassembly: If your dorm room has furniture that can be disassembled, take it apart to save space during storage.
- Use Vacuum Bags: Vacuum storage bags are great for compressing bulky items like bedding and clothing.
- Document Inventory: Create an inventory list of the items you're storing.
- Security: Ensure your stored items are secure. If you're using a storage unit, use a good quality lock.
- Pack Essentials Separately: Pack a separate box or bag with essential items you might need immediately after moving back in, such as bedding, toiletries, and a few changes of clothes.
- Don't Overload Boxes: Be mindful of the weight limit for your storage containers. Overloaded boxes can be challenging to move and may cause damage.
